Abstract

A method and apparatus for managing network attached storage that includes detecting frequency of access from a client to a data item that is in a first server in the network attached storage, a global namespace of the network attached storage indicating an access address for accessing the data item, the access address including a first address of the data item in the first server; in response to the frequency being higher than a predetermined threshold, copying the data item from the first server to a second server in the network attached storage which is proximate to the client, so as to form a data image; and updating the global namespace so as to add to the access address a second address of the data image in the second server whereby the data access efficiency of the network attached storage can be considerably improved.

technical field [0001] Various embodiments of the present invention relate to storage management, and more particularly, to methods and devices for managing Network Attached Storage (NAS). Background technique [0002] On the one hand, with the development of data storage technology, various data storage devices have been able to provide users with higher and higher data storage capabilities, and the data access speed has also been greatly improved. On the other hand, the development of network technology has opened up a new direction for data storage. Data storage devices are no longer limited to being deployed locally on data access devices, but can be located in any physical location accessible via the network. [0003] Currently, network attached storage has been developed, which is an emerging data storage technology.
